Classification
Under binomial nomenclature, Psilolechia is Psilolechia[6]. Psilolechia is classified at the rank of genus[4]. Psilolechia belongs to the parent taxon Pilocarpaceae (1905)[5]. The taxonomic type of Psilolechia is Psilolechia lucida[8]. Psilolechia is commonly known as {'lang': 'nl', 'text': 'Wortelkorst'}[10].
